Carol A. Bower, 76, of New Philadelphia, passed away peacefully on Tuesday, March 19, 2024, in Country Club Retirement Campus at Dover.

Born in Dover, Carol was one of three daughters born to the late Carl and Mary Totten. Carol loved being artistic and it was because of this that she was able to showcase her talents as owner and operator Fancy Fingers at New Philadelphia and will be remembered by many for her nail art. Carol was also an avid bowler and had been inducted into the USBC Bowling Hall of Fame and had attended Trinity Episcopal Church at New Philadelphia.

Carol is survived by her former husband and still best friend, Brad Bower of New Philadelphia; her daughters, Amanda Simon of Brooklyn, New York and Melissa (Christopher) Harris of New Philadelphia; her loving niece that she thought of as a daughter, Heidi Hoffman; her five grandchildren, Zach (Amanda) Harris, Kylie Harris, Dirk Thomas, Desiree Thomas and Donna Young; her great grandson, Lorenzo Rainsburg and many nieces and nephews.

In addition to her parents, Carol was preceded in death by a daughter, Heather Dudley and her two sisters, Sharon Merrell and Betty Hoffman.

In keeping with Carol’s wishes, cremation care is to be provided by the Linn-Hert-Geib Funeral Home & Crematory at New Philadelphia and a celebration of Carol’s life will be held at a later date.
